Just a 5-minute walk from Cambridge Railway Station, the YHA has a traditional restaurant and games room. The historical centre and Cambridge University Colleges are a 15-minute walk away. The YHA Cambridge Hostel offers dormitory bedrooms with shared bathroom facilities. The majority of rooms contain bunk beds. The games room features a pool table, TV lounge area and computer stations, and Wi-Fi is also accessible. The on-site restaurant serves hearty evening meals and light snacks. The YHA bar offers bottled beers and fresh coffees, and there is also a kitchen and barbecue for self-catering guests. Set in a Victorian town house, the YHA Cambridge is a 15-minute walk from the Grand Arcade Shopping Centre. The University Botanic Garden is a 5-minute walk, and the Clifton Leisure Complex is half a mile away. Hostel: 100 rooms , Hotel Chain: YHA.
